Kozloski-StrattonLinda Mary Stratton, daughter of Mr. and Mrs. William A. Stratton of Windsor Locks, was married to Edward Francis Kozloski son of Mr. and Mrs. Edward M. Kozloski of Suffield at St. Mary’s Church, Windsor Locks.The Rev. Michael C. DeVito officiated at the Oct. 8, morning ceremony.Serving as honor attendant was Ellen Marie Stratton.Bridesmaids were Carol Maxwell, Nancy Bagley, Kathleen Stratton, Jane Herzig, and Nancy Cooper.Serving as best man wasWilliam A. Stratton Jr. Ushers were Derek Maxwell, William Bagley, Thomas Stratton, Daniel Profant, and Henry Dobson.The bride, a graduate of Western Connecticut StateCollege, Danbury, in nursing, is employed by Johnson Memorial Hospital in Stafford.Kozloski is a graduate of Western Connecticut StateCollege, with a B.A. in earth science, and is employed by Springborne Laboratories in Enfield.Following a reception at the Suffield Inn, the couple left on a wedding trip along the NewEngland coastline.They will make their home in Windsor Locks.
